NAME

       tixScrolledListBox    -    Create   and   manipulate   Tix
       ScrolledListBox widgets


SYNOPSIS

       tixScrolledListBox pathName ?options?

WIDGET-SPECIFIC OPTIONS

       Command-Line Name:-anchor
       Database Name:  anchor
       Database Class: Anchor

              Specifies  the  alignment  of  the items inside the
              listbox subwidget.  Only the values  w  and  e  are
              allowed.  When  set  to w, the listbox is automati­
              cally aligned to the beginning of the items.   When
              set  to  e, the listbox is automatically aligned to
              the end of the items.  Automatically alignment only
              happens when the ScrolledListBox widget changes its
              size.

       Command-Line Name:-browsecmd
       Database Name:  browsecmd
       Database Class: BrowseCmd

              Specifies the command to be called  when  the  user
              browses  the  elements inside the listbox subwidget
              (see the BINDINGS section below).

       Command-Line Name:-command
       Database Name:  command
       Database Class: Command

              Specifies the command to be called  when  the  user
              invokes  the  listbox  subwidget  (see the BINDINGS
              section below).

       Command-Line Name:-height
       Database Name:  height
       Database Class: Height

              Specifies the desired height  for  the  window,  in
              pixels.

       Command-Line Name:-scrollbar

       Database Class: Scrollbar

              Specifies the display policy of the scrollbars. The
              following values are recognized:

              auto ?+x? ?-x? ?+y? ?-y?
                     When  -scrollbar  is  set  to  "auto",   the
                     scrollbars are shown only when needed. Addi­
                     tional modifiers can  be  used  to  force  a
                     scrollbar  to  be shown or hidden. For exam­
                     ple, "auto -y" means the horizontal  scroll­
                     bar should be shown when needed but the ver­
                     tical scrollbar  should  always  be  hidden;
                     "auto   +x"  means  the  vertical  scrollbar
                     should be shown when needed but the horizon­
                     tal scrollbar should always be shown, and so
                     on.

              both   Both scrollbars are shown

              none   The scrollbars are never shown.

              x      Only the horizontal scrollbar is shown;

              y      Only the vertical scrollbar is shown.

       Command-Line Name:-width
       Database Name:  width
       Database Class: Width

              Specifies the desired width for the window, in pix­
              els.


SUBWIDGETS

       Name:           hsb
       Class:          Scrollbar

              The horizontal scrollbar subwidget.

       Name:           listbox
       Class:          Listbox

              The  listbox  subwidget  inside the ScrolledListBox
              widget.

       Name:           vsb
       Class:          Scrollbar

              The vertical scrollbar subwidget.

WIDGET COMMANDS

       The  tixScrolledListBox  command creates a new Tcl command
       whose  name  is  the  same  as  the  path  name   of   the
       ScrolledListBox  widget's window. This command may be used
       to invoke various operations on the  widget.  It  has  the
       following general form:
                     pathName option ?arg arg ...?

       PathName  is the name of the command, which is the same as
       the ScrolledListBox widget's path  name.  Option  and  the
       args  determine  the  exact  behavior of the command.  The
       following commands are possible for  ScrolledListBox  wid­
       gets:

       pathName cget option
              Returns  the  current  value  of  the configuration
              option given by option. Option may have any of  the
              values  accepted by the tixScrolledListBox command.

       pathName configure ?option? ?value option value ...?
              Query or modify the configuration  options  of  the
              widget.   If no option is specified, returns a list
              describing all of the available options  for  path­
              Name  (see  Tk_ConfigureInfo for information on the
              format of this list).  If option is specified  with
              no  value, then the command returns a list describ­
              ing the one named option (this list will be identi­
              cal  to  the  corresponding  sublist  of  the value
              returned if no option is  specified).   If  one  or
              more  option-value  pairs  are  specified, then the
              command modifies the given widget option(s) to have
              the  given  value(s);  in  this  case  the  command
              returns an empty string.  Option may  have  any  of
              the  values accepted by the tixScrolledListBox com­
              mand.

       pathName subwidget  name ?args?
              When no additional arguments are given, returns the
              pathname of the subwidget of the specified name.

              When  no additional arguments are given, the widget
              command of the specified subwidget will  be  called
              with these parameters.


BINDINGS

       [1]    If  the -browsecmd option is set, the command which
              it referes to is called whenever a  <ButtonPress-1>
              or  a  <Motion-1>  event occurrs inside the listbox


       [2]    The command specified by  the  -command  option  is
              invoked  when a <Double-1> event occurrs inside the
              listbox subwidget.


BUGS

       The capitalization of some of the commands  names  in  Tix
       3.x  has  been changed in Tix 4.0. All commands that ended
       with box have been changed to a  capitalized  Box.  Hence,
       the command tixScrolledListbox in Tix 3.x has been changed
       to tixScrolledListBox in Tix 4.0
